Application of surfactants in unconventional liquid reservoirs (ULR) for both frac and EOR applications has been the subject of speculation, controversy, disappointment and in some cases, success. In this presentation, we attempt to come to a greater understanding of what governs the process and how to better design surfactant systems to capitalize on the imbibition mechanism via wettability alteration. Lab results showing how to design surfactant molecules for specific applications will be presented. It will be demonstrated that surfactants (nonionic, cationic and anionic) must be designed on a case by case basis that accounts for oil properties, salinity, mineralogy and reservoir temperature.
